Output 6e84fd931737591d08200d7e727e068f17f9a5d23368f3311c9bc3e57a4552fd:25

value
1684210
script pubkey
OP_0 OP_PUSHBYTES_20 d14e5ee56ea21b88eba80b41e7b02b79d4ba2fcb
address
bc1q6989aetw5gdc36agpdq70vpt082t5t7tffnep5
transaction
6e84fd931737591d08200d7e727e068f17f9a5d23368f3311c9bc3e57a4552fd
spent
true